## Onboarding — EchoHall Audio Guide

Welcome to the EchoHall team. The app serves audio tours for the Vastermere Gallery and syncs exhibit metadata nightly from the curator CMS. For your security review, note that all transcripts are public content; only the CMS sync channel is sensitive. Local setup: copy `env.sample` to `.env`, set `ECHO_CMS_URL` to the sandbox instance, and leave `ECHO_CACHE_TTL` at its default. The sandbox sync credential is the last thing to configure, and it belongs on the very next line.

env line for fafof-fahag: LEDGER_TOKEN5=f8790

Subject: Key rotation — Sheetpress export service

Rotating the Sheetpress credential ahead of the 4.2 release. Background: the spreadsheet export worker was holding full workbooks in memory, and the fix in 4.2 streams rows instead, cutting peak usage by roughly 70%. The old key is revoked at cutover; anything pinned to it will fail exports. Please confirm the release pipeline and the Gridhaven staging jobs pick up the new value before Thursday. The replacement key for the internal export gateway is below.

app token of bawep-hafog = kto7_vwrmnlx

## Canary Gating — Provenance

Promotion decisions in the Marrowfield pipeline are made only against artifacts with verified provenance. Each canary candidate must carry a signed attestation linking source revision, builder identity, and gating-policy version. Unsigned artifacts are rejected before the 1% stage. Reviewers can cross-check any promotion event against the attestation ledger using the build token shown below.

pipeline stamp: htk4_c337

Subject: Key rotation with the Brennock broker upgrade

Team,

As part of upgrading the Brennock message broker from 4.2 to 5.0, we are rotating all credentials used by the consumer fleet in the Talverra cluster. The old keys stop working once the blue/green cutover completes, so please review the config diff carefully — especially the retry and ack-timeout changes, which interact with the new auth handshake. Staging has already been migrated and soak-tested for 48 hours.

For your review environment, use the replacement key below.

service key, bajeg-bagef: qvz3-vkh